Justin Firestone, with nearly three decades of experience in the private jet industry, has established himself as a pioneering and influential figure in both the United States and Asia.
In addition to his role as Founder of TLC Jet, Firestone serves as a strategic advisor to the senior leadership team at American Airlines.
In 2013, Firestone co-founded Wheels Up, which began trading on the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E) under the ticker “UP” as a publicly traded company in 2021. In 2023, Delta Air Lines acquired a majority stake in Wheels Up.
Firestone has consistently demonstrated a proven track record of creating value and delivering tangible results for his clients, partners, and investors.
He has spearheaded the establishment, leadership, and sale of several successful companies within the private jet industry, including Asia Jet and eBizJets. Furthermore, he has held executive positions with renowned global brands, such as Hawker Beechcraft and Marquis Jet. Additionally, he has cultivated a strong network of relationships with prominent business, sports, and entertainment figures. His contributions have been recognized through various accolades.
Firestone has received numerous publications and awards for his leadership and expertise in the aviation industry. He is passionate about advancing the private jet industry and making it more accessible, efficient, and sustainable.
Firestone is a proud third-generation Miamian who resides in Pinecrest with his wife, Natalie, and their three children, Ashley, Alexa, and Bradley.
J.J. Greenstein is a seasoned professional in sports and aviation business development.
Prior to launching TLC Jet, he served as a Sales Executive at Wheels Up, a private aviation company, where he contributed to strategic growth initiatives.
Greenstein began his career in sports ticketing, joining the University of Miami Athletics department in August 2015 as an Account Executive for Ticket Sales. During his time in Coral Gables, he completed his master’s degree in strategic communication.
Before that, he worked with IMG Learfield Ticket Solutions at Duke University, focusing on sales for the football and basketball programs. His earlier roles include positions with the Durham Bulls Baseball Club and as a Program Monitor for Athletic Compliance at North Carolina State University, his alma mater. He graduated from N.C. State in 2012 with a bachelor’s degree in Sport Management.
A native of Cary, North Carolina, J.J. now resides in Pinecrest with his wife, Melissa, and daughter, Finley.
He has built a career at the intersection of sports and aviation, leveraging his expertise to drive growth and engagement in both athletics and private aviation sectors.
Taylor Randall was born in Huntington, New York, raised in Naperville, Illinois, and now resides in Delray Beach, Florida.
Prior to joining TLC Jet, Taylor served as a Global Account Manager at Wheels Up, where he oversaw key relationships with business, university, and high-net-worth clients—driving member experience, retention, and revenue growth.
Before his time in private aviation, Taylor built a career in hospitality, specializing in the private country club sector. Most notably, he served as Head Golf Professional at the prestigious Congressional Country Club in Bethesda, Maryland.
Taylor is a proud graduate of Penn State University. Outside of work, he’s an avid golfer, a passionate Penn State football fan, and enjoys spending time with his wife Jennifer, their daughter Millie, and their mini Goldendoodle, Juno.
